We are looking for a Locum Dental Practitioner/Locum Dentist to cover an assignment with the Ministry of Defence (MoD), at RAF Cranwell Dental Centre, in Sleaford, Lincolnshire. This is a locum role (37 hours per week) and the successful candidate will deliver an exceptional standard of care to the MoD service personnel. Pay rates:
PAYE £48.68 per hour
Self-employed - £55.98 per hour Main duties of the job
- To work independently and to provide both a full range of dental treatment to maintain oral health and to undertake related general administrative duties where required to work towards improving and maintaining the dental health and operational fitness of personnel for whom they are providing care for.
- To assist the Senior Dental Officer (SDO), when present, or operate independently to achieve dental fitness targets, for all entitled personnel, as detailed in the SG Policy and Standards Document (P&SD).
- To ensure that not less than 6.5 hours per day in 2 sessions are set aside for direct patient contact.
- To ensure that all treatment is correctly recorded on the electronic health record and any relevant FMed documents.

- Essential Requirements/ Qualifications/ Experience:
- Fully registered with the General Dental Council (GDC) without restrictions.
- Certified completion of Foundation Training in Dentistry in the UK, or have evidence of at least 12 months full-time postgraduate clinical experience derived in a primary dental care setting, or have qualified before foundation training became compulsory in the NHS.
- Must hold valid suitable and appropriate indemnity insurance with a recognised dental defence organisation.
- Must provide evidence of clinical currency in accordance with JSP 950 Leaflet 4-1-4 Returning to Clinical Practice, specifically a minimum of 2 clinical sessions per week over the last 15 months.
- To have completed GDC highly recommended Continuing Professional Development (CPD) including medical emergencies, safeguarding children and vulnerable adults, disinfection and decontamination, radiography and radiation protection.
- To be trained and current in emergency and resuscitation procedures and have practised and tested these procedures at least annually in accordance with Resuscitation Council (UK) guidelines and JSP 950 Leaflet 4-6-1 DMS CPR Standards and Training.
- Must have undertaken the additional health clearance checks for clinicians required to perform Exposure Prone Procedures (in accordance with the Department of Health policy entitled Health clearance for tuberculosis, hepatitis B, hepatitis C and HIV: New Healthcare Workers).
- Must be in date and able to provide certification for Safeguarding Children and Young People and Safeguarding Adults up to and including Level 3 training.
